We present a system of pulse-coupled oscillators (PCOs) based on the resonate-and-fire neuron (RFN) model for an application to clock synchronization protocol for wireless sensor networks. Firstly, we show a novel type of PCO derived from the RFN model and its Type I/Type II phase response properties. Secondly, we demonstrate that global phase synchronization in a network of the RFNs as PCOs are robust against transmission delays. Finally, we propose a possible scheme for compensation of transmission delays.
